首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

当数据在任何处理器中排队时,如何在NiFi中创建警报?

在NiFi中,可以使用Processors和Controller Services来监控数据在处理器中的排队情况,并设置警报以及相关的动作。

要在NiFi中创建警报,可以按照以下步骤进行操作:

  1. 配置FlowFile Queue报警:FlowFile Queue是用于存储在处理器之间传递的数据的队列。可以在每个Process Group中的Processor配置界面中设置报警阈值。当队列中的FlowFile数量超过设定的阈值时,将会触发警报。
    • 警报配置:在Processor配置界面中,找到Queue tab,在"Threshold for queue size"字段中设置阈值。可以选择警告或错误级别,并设置触发警报时的操作,例如发送电子邮件或调用其他Processor执行特定的操作。
    • 相关的腾讯云产品:NiFi是一个开源的数据流处理和自动化工具,腾讯云提供了用于构建大数据分析和处理的云原生产品,例如TencentDB for PostgreSQL用于存储和管理数据,云函数SCF用于触发特定操作。
  • 使用监控报警Processor:NiFi中有一些特定的Processors可以用于监控和报警,例如MonitorActivity和MonitorDiskUsage。这些Processors可以监控NiFi系统的活动和磁盘使用情况,并在达到预设的阈值时触发警报。
    • 警报配置:在相应的Monitor Processor配置界面中,可以设置报警的条件,例如CPU使用率、内存使用率、磁盘使用率等。同样,可以选择警告或错误级别,并设置触发警报时的操作。
    • 相关的腾讯云产品:腾讯云提供了云监控产品,例如云监控CMQ用于实时监控云资源的指标,云日志CLS用于实时日志的采集和分析,可以与NiFi结合使用来实现更灵活的监控和报警。

需要注意的是,NiFi本身并没有直接提供警报功能,而是通过监控数据队列和使用监控报警Processor来实现警报功能。另外,在实际使用中,可以根据具体的需求和情况选择适合的警报方式和操作,例如发送邮件、调用其他服务、写入日志等。

希望以上内容能够帮助您理解在NiFi中如何创建警报。如有更多问题,请随时提问。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 领券